Drosera rotundifolia, commonly known as the round-leaved sundew, is a carnivorous and perennial plant species belonging to the Droseraceae family. This species is widely distributed in the cool and moist regions of the Northern Hemisphere, particularly thriving in nutrient-poor, acidic environments such as peat bogs and marshes. In addition to producing energy through photosynthesis, it supplements its nutritional needs by capturing small insects using sticky secretions on its leaves. This adaptation enables it to survive in low-nutrient habitats.
Drosera rotundifolia is a plant that grows in a rosette form and lacks a thin, elongated stem. Its leaves are circular with slightly hairy edges. The reddish hairs (tentacles) on the leaf surface secrete a sticky substance used to attract and trap insects. The plant digests the captured insects to obtain nutrients such as nitrogen and phosphorus.
Drosera rotundifolia is capable of photosynthesis; however, due to the nutrient-poor nature of its habitats, it fulfills its additional nutritional requirements by digesting insects. After capturing prey, the tentacles on its leaves secrete digestive enzymes and absorb the insect’s internal contents. This process provides the essential nutrients required for the plant’s growth and development.

Drosera rotundifolia is commonly found in the cool and moist regions of the Northern Hemisphere. It naturally grows in Europe, Asia, and North America, particularly in Scandinavia, Russia, Canada, and the northern regions of the United States. This broad geographical distribution demonstrates the species’ ability to adapt to a variety of climatic and soil conditions.
This species typically occurs in peat bogs, marshes, and other moist areas with acidic soils. It thrives in association with Sphagnum mosses, which create the acidic environment necessary for its growth. Soil pH typically ranges between 3.2 and 7.3, and the plant shows no tolerance for saline soils. It prefers open, sunny areas over shaded ones.

Drosera rotundifolia plays a significant ecological role in its habitats. By capturing insects to obtain nutrients such as nitrogen and phosphorus, it actively participates in nutrient cycling. Furthermore, this adaptation allows the plant to survive in low-nutrient environments and gain a competitive advantage over non-carnivorous species.
